Finals time

The Northern Region rugby competitions wind up this weekend for four Bay of Plenty representative teams.

A long journey north, and a Sunday afternoon match, is the twin challenge that awaits the Bay of Plenty Development team. The match against Northland in Whangarei will give the Bay representatives their best, and last, opportunity to post a victory in the Northern Region competition this season.
While yet to post a win in the highly competitive second 15 championships, the local representatives have never given up the battle. Last weekend they led the Auckland Emerging players for much of the match, before succumbing 17-13.
An important role of the side coached by Steve Axtens is to provide cover for the Steamers. Several of the Steamers who are returning from injury have had a run in the development team before resuming their place in the top echelon squad.
While the Bay under 16 side were devastated to lose their Northern Region semi-final on count back after the scores were tied at 19 all, they are ready to finish their season with a flourish on Saturday.
Playing against North Harbour for third place in the championship, motivation will be provided by last week's disappointment and the desire to retain an otherwise unbeaten season record.
Counties Manukau at Pukekohe are the Bay of Plenty under 18 team's opposition. While defeated by the might of Auckland last Saturday, they showed their potential with two solid wins in the previous eight days. Victory over Counties would see the Bay finish near the top of the Northern Region points ladder.
Another big challenge awaits the Bay of Plenty Secondary Schoolgirls with a game against North Harbour in Northcote. While the side have struggled somewhat against the might of the larger Northern unions, they have never given up the fight.
